From: scottjbrownlee on 5 May 2008 21:44 I have ppt 2002, and am trying to have multiple animated gifs on the same page (overlapped). Basically, I have each one "appearing" on a mouse click, and then doing it's animation without a loop, then another mouse click to activate the next gif animation on top of the first (I am doing this with 8 gif animations). The weird thing is that the animation doesn't always work. Sometimes as I mouse click the animated gif is already halfway through or other times it is already at it's last image. The animated gif very rarely starts and ends correctly.
From: John Wilson john AT technologytrish.co DOT on 6 May 2008 02:55 Animated gifs run even when they are not visible! There's no way to control them in PowerPoint that I know of. What you need can probably be done with animation within PowerPoint though using "Flash Once" for each frame.
